Uttar Pradesh is the rainbow land where the multi-hued Indian Culture has
blossomed from times immemorial. Blessed with a variety of geographical
topographies and many cultural diversities, Uttar Pradesh, has been the hub of
activity of historical and religious heroes like - Rama, Krishna, Buddha,
Mahavira, Ashoka, Harsha, Akbar and Mahatma Gandhi. Rich and tranquil expanses
of meadows, perennial rivers, dense forests and fertile soil of Uttar Pradesh
have contributed numerous golden chapters to the annals of Indian History.
Dotted with various holy shrines and pilgrimage places, full of joyous
festivals, it plays an important role in the politics, education, culture,
industry, agriculture and tourism of India.
Area wise, it is the fourth largest State of India. In sheer magnitude it is
half of the area of France, three times of Portugal, four times of Ireland,
seven times of Switzerland, ten times of Belgium and a little bigger than
England. The administrative and legislative capital is Lucknow and the judicial
capital is Allahabad. Other notable cities include Agra, Aligarh, Ayodhya,
Varanasi (Benares), Gorakhpur, Kanpur.
